2. The forces that will shape AI’s future
AI’s future does not advance in a single direction. It moves through the convergence of technical, energy and cognitive forces that reconfigure the landscape.
a) Miniaturisation and efficiency
The dominant trend is clear: smaller, faster, more efficient models.
Not to compete with today’s giants, but to inhabit the environment: sensors, cars, phones, appliances, public infrastructure. The AI of the future will be less “centralised” and more ubiquitous, integrated into every node of the system.
b) Sensory multimodality
AI’s language will be perception.
Not text, but vision, audio, contextual signals, ambient data, integrated into a single flow. AI will not “receive instructions”, it will interpret environments.
c) Autonomous agents
The next layer will be action.
Agents are systems capable of acting, planning and coordinating tasks, delegating complete parts of processes. They will stop being conversational assistants and become digital operators, autonomous within defined limits.
d) Cost per task
The decisive metric will not be parameter count, but how much it costs for a system to solve a task with human-level quality. This metric will reorder markets, business models and technological priorities.
The convergence of these forces does not create a more spectacular AI, but a more integrated, more organic and more everyday one.
3. Towards post-AI organisations
The question is not how companies will adopt AI, but what companies natively built for a world where AI is already infrastructure will look like. This change is not about software licenses, but about organisational model.
Future organisations will have three characteristics:
a) Structured operational delegation
AI will not “assist” tasks: it will execute complete parts of processes. Post-AI companies will design their workflows so that agents operate as parallel teams, not as tools.
b) Hybrid human-agent architectures
Human supervision will be more strategic than tactical. The human role will shift from execution to definition, verification, contextualisation and resolution of moral or interpretive ambiguities.
c) Distributed capabilities in layers
AI will be at every point of the process: data capture, analysis, decision, execution, verification, traceability.
This is not a distant scenario: it is a shift in how we organise responsibilities, not just tools.
4. Tomorrow’s ethics: tensions that do not yet exist
AI ethics will not be today’s. As we delegate more cognitive tasks, tensions will appear that we are only beginning to glimpse.
Among them:
Cognitive delegation — How much thought can we externalise without losing agency? The question is not technical, but philosophical.
Composite systems — When multiple agents cooperate, responsibility becomes diffuse. Who answers when a multi-agent system fails?
Reality vs. synthesis — Multimodal generation will create an environment where distinguishing what is real will be a conscious act, not an automatic reflex.
Concentrated technological power — AI infrastructure may end up in the hands of few actors. The challenge will be to democratise capabilities, not just regulate risks.
Environmental and energy impact — A world full of models running on thousands of devices raises an ecological debate different from that of today’s large models.
Future ethics will be an ethics of delegation, distributed responsibility and contextual truth.
5. Structural scenarios of the future
AI’s future will not arrive in a single form. Three scenarios are more likely to coexist:
Incremental scenario
AI integrates gradually into sectors and services. Changes are stable, predictable and accumulative.
Transformative scenario
Autonomous agents occupy complete parts of financial, healthcare, administrative and logistical systems. Society reorganises around new capabilities.
Restrictive scenario
A serious incident, a social distortion or a systemic risk triggers stronger regulations that limit or slow the operational autonomy of AI.
The three scenarios could coexist. The key will be to design resilient, auditable and flexible systems.
